That would be an interesting way to go about it but I think that it would only give us a historic view of which conference is better over the long run, which can be decided in the tournament given that there's equal treatment in seeding and number of teams. To start off all teams should play the same amount of conference games. Second no conference should get more than 3 teams in the playoffs as this will give the non power 2 conferences a chance to prove them self. The NFL does this and it rewards the top seeded teams with an "eazy" game to start the playoffs while allowing everyone a chance to make a run. I agree that there should be more cross conference games between the power conference. One out of conference game a year should be scheduled against another power conference on rotating basis between the power 4 with 1/3 of the conference teams playing each other power conference. I realize this would take equal teams in each conference. The NFL really does have all of this already figured out the model just needs to be adopted by college.
